Custom Domain Architecture
GN-Apex allows organizations to connect independently-owned domains with zero server management:
Single-Record Ingress
Point your domain's CNAME record to our global edge ingress (ingress.gnapex.com) to activate edge acceleration.
Automated Edge SSL
Dedicated TLS 1.3 cryptographic certificates are automatically provisioned and renewed with zero manual maintenance.
Independent Project Binding
Connect domains to your organization first, then attach or re-route them between different website nodes anytime.
Instant Live Verification
Our verification engine queries public DNS edge resolvers in real time to activate traffic routing the moment records propagate.
Apex Edge SSL / TLS 1.3
Every custom domain connected to GN-Apex benefits from automated cryptographic protection:
- Zero Configuration: No certificate files to upload or renew. Certificates are issued automatically upon DNS verification.
- HTTP/3 & TLS 1.3: Supports the latest web protocols for fast handshake speeds on mobile networks.
- Automated Renewal: Certificates are auto-renewed 30 days before expiration.
Connecting an Existing Domain
Navigate to Domains → Connect Existing Domain. Enter your domain name (e.g. mybrand.com) and optionally pick which project to link it to immediately.
Log into your domain provider (e.g. GoDaddy, Namecheap) and add the following CNAME record:
Return to your GN-Apex dashboard and click Verify DNS. Once detected, your status switches to VERIFIED, and SSL activates automatically.
Decoupled Project Assignment
Domains are owned by your Organization, meaning you can switch a custom domain from Landing Page A to Main Store B in one click without re-verifying DNS records.
